No dried krill - most lions will not touch that stuff - would you.
Okay I've had a fuzzy for years & some times mine wont eat from time to time also. Here is usually what I feed mind.
Squid - any of the types available in the lfs.
VHP - it's stands for Very High Protein - Not sure about the brand
 

wrigley11

Member
Forgot - make sure to let the food sit on the counter before feeding. If the food is frozen, alot of lions will not touch it.

Now is the time to retest and post your water parameters and history...
What exactly is Ammonia,nitrIte,nitrAte readings...
You say the Lions been in the tank for 8 months...when and who was the latest addition...
Lost coloration, gasping, laying on bottom, and not eating indicate some other problem...
Are there any other "signs/clues" on the Lion...What about the other fish in the tank...breathing,color,eyes,etc...?
